DN14 0AE is a quiet, settled residential neighbourhood on Main Street, 0.5km from Gowdall in Gowdall. Administratively it sits within Snaith, Airmyn, Rawcliffe and Marshland ward and the Brigg and Goole constituency.

This is a strong family neighbourhood — a spacious suburb popular with older working households approaching retirement. During the day, higher status countryside accessible from major metropolitan areas. This is a settled, family-oriented neighbourhood (average age 52) — stable, lower-turnover, predominantly owner-occupied. 88% of properties are owner-occupied — a strong indicator of neighbourhood stability and long-term community investment.

Safety: Crime rates are low here at 11 incidents per 1,000 residents — well below average and reassuring for families. Property: Average house prices are around £270k, up 32.1% year-on-year.

Census 2021 statistics for DN14 0AE are sourced from Output Area E00065964 (shared with 16 postcodes in this micro-neighbourhood). Property prices come from HM Land Registry.
